Monthly climate in Itambe, Brazil

Last updated: July 31, 2025

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Itambe features a tropical savanna climate (Aw). Temperatures typically range between 20 °C (68 °F) and 26 °C (78 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to 10 °C (50 °F) or can rise to as high as 38 °C (100 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 838 mm (33.0 inches) and receives 152 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Itambe enjoys an average of 3387 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 11 hours 13 minutes to 13 hours 0 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Itambe, Brazil

The warmest months in Itambe are January, February and March,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 25 to 26 °C (77 - 78 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in June, July and August, when daily mean temperatures range from 20 to 21 °C (68 - 70 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Itambe experiences 282 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 0 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Itambe, Brazil

Itambe usually has the most precipitation in March, November and December, with an average of 14 rainy days and 124 mm (4.9 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Itambe are January, June and September. On average, 44 mm (1.7 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ly sunshine hours in Itambe, Brazil

The sunniest months in Itambe are March, October and December, when the sun shines an average of 9 hours 40 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Itambe: May, June and November receive an average of 8 hours 42 minutes of sunshine daily.

Solar UV radiation in Itambe, Brazil

Itambe exper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in January, November and December,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 15 - 15, which corresponds to the Extreme category of sun exposure. May, June and July are in the Very High ex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 10.
